The above photo is a picture of the lip glosses I bought and tried. I was very excited to get my hands on the N.Y.C. liquid lip shine in the color: sungold pink. (to see a list of more Nars dupes check out this blog called "Mystical makeup and beauty") I had to check several stores to find it. I liked the shade and see where it would be a "keep in your purse must!" since it goes well with both pink, neutral and peachy lipstick. My favorites from this shopping trip was the Revlon lip gloss in any color! They are thick and stay on nice- without being to gummy.
Shown above is the Milani blush in "Luminous" which is also listed on several dupe list as being a dupe for the Nars blush in "Orgasm". I loved this blush!! By the way did I happen to mention I hate trying to buy blush I either get it to dark, or to light. Well this blush stood up to it's reputation - it was not only the perfect color, but it did not commit to being peachy, or pink, so I can wear it with either color palette- Love it!! I also tried the Loreal HIP eyeshadow duo in Mystical 319. I had to go buy this eyeshadow after watching AllthatGlitters21 tutorial on how to use this eyeshadow! I will tell you I had to go to 4 stores before I found this one still in stock in this color. I love this look, it is my main, go to spring eye look! THE LIPSTICK EFFECT

The "lipstick effect" I know you all are thinking what is that? Could it be where my lip print remains on my coffee cup after I take a sip, the added mint flavoring to my lip gloss to help freshen my breath? The come hear look I can send my husband once I have gussied up for the evening. (Well it is closer to the last one) I heard on the NBC nightly news broadcast with Brian Williams that there was a study done showing that the sale of lipstick was high even during these hard times.
Why did the sale of Lipstick of all things go up during a recession you ask? Well so did I, so I googled this new terminology "lipstick effect" and found a wonderful web site Phys.org that had an article written about a study that Professor Nancy Upton had done that stated: “During the Depression, we saw something referred to as the ‘Lipstick Effect,’ which showed an increase in the consumer purchase of cosmetics, especially lipstick,” she says. “What we saw was a consumer trying to make themselves feel better through small, indulgent, hedonic consumption.”
So that made me start thinking what was my "Lipstick effect"? What do I purchase to give myself a little lift or what do I still treat myself to even though I am watching our budget and cutting back???

I believe my "indulgence" is probably nice hand lotion, a cup of coffee from Starbucks (I have cut way back now only about 1 a month) and yes, I confess I have bought lipstick!
